The landscape of professional football has actually transformed substantially over the years, with athlete wellness and efficiency becoming a main focus. Modern-day clubs now dedicate extensive resources to holistic care systems that go beyond traditional training routines.

The structure of contemporary football player welfare relies on comprehending the intricate physical requirements placed upon athletes throughout training and competition. Today\'s footballers sustain remarkable physical strain, with elite competitors covering distances going beyond 10 kilometers per match while implementing high-intensity sprints, leaps, and directional shifts. This demanding arena necessitates sophisticated observation systems that track every detail from heart monitoring variability to muscular exhaustion markers. Cutting-edge wearable tools currently delivers real-time data on player workload, enabling mentoring staff to make informed choices concerning training intensity and restoration times. Football injury prevention has become as a crucial aspect of contemporary club management, with teams spending significant resources in evidence-based strategies to minimize the risk of player problems. Modern prevention initiatives concentrate on pinpointing and addressing biomechanical imbalances, muscle weaknesses, and motion patterns that predispose athletes to particular injury categories. Thorough evaluation methods currently look at all aspects from ankle joint mobility to hip steadiness, creating detailed profiles of each player's physical attributes and possible susceptibilities. Such assessments drive targeted strategies that might involve reparative routines, personalized training loads, or particular equipment usage.

Maximizing athletic performance in professional football requires a multi-faceted technique that combines research-based concepts with workable application in competitive environments. Present-day performance improvement strategies include strength and conditioning programs customized to individual player demands, dietary interventions crafted to support training responses and recovery stages, as well as psychological support systems addressing the psychological requirements of top-tier competition. Formulating training intensity throughout the season provides that players excel at key moments, while keeping steady efficiency levels over extended periods. Football wellness programs today address every aspect of player well-being, from hydration recipes and supplement use to tension control and life counseling. Such holistic athlete care programs recognize that optimal efficiency comes from the careful combination of numerous variables, requiring continuous surveillance and adaptation to specific reactions and altering conditions throughout the competitive schedule. The duty of sports physiotherapy in modern-day football expands beyond conventional injury treatment, incorporating efficiency enhancements, mobility optimization, and long-term athlete development. Contemporary physiotherapists at elite clubs hold specialized knowledge of football-specific movement patterns, energy systems, and the unique requirements expected of multiple playing positions. These specialists employ cutting-edge handbook therapy, workout prescription, and movement evaluation to ensure peak athlete activity throughout competitive seasons. The blend of state-of-the-art tools, such as biomechanical analysis systems, curative ultrasound, and pneumatic compression instruments has boosted the precision and utility of sports physiotherapy solutions.
